The Importance Of Oil Seals In Automotive And Machinery Industries

Oil seals, also known as grease seals, are essential components in various industries, especially in automotive and machinery sectors. These seals play a crucial role in preventing the leakage of fluids, such as oil or grease, and protecting the internal components of the equipment. In this article, we will delve deeper into the significance of oil seals, their functions, types, and the importance of proper maintenance.

One of the primary functions of oil seals is to prevent the leakage of fluids from the housing or shaft in machinery. In automotive applications, oil seals are used to seal the components of the engine, transmission, and wheel bearings. These seals help to retain the lubricating oil within the system and prevent contaminants from entering, which could lead to premature wear and damage.

Oil seals are typically made of synthetic rubber or elastomers, which are flexible and durable materials that can withstand high temperatures and pressure. They are designed to fit snugly around the shaft or housing to create a tight seal that prevents leakage. The construction of oil seals includes a metal case, a rubber sealing element, a garter spring, and a dust lip. The metal case provides structural support and rigidity to the seal, while the rubber element is responsible for providing the sealing function.

There are several types of oil seals available in the market, each designed for specific applications and operating conditions. The most common types include radial shaft seals, axial shaft seals, and rotary shaft seals. Radial shaft seals are used to seal rotating shafts and are the most widely used type of oil seal. Axial shaft seals, on the other hand, are used to seal linear motion components, such as piston rods or hydraulic cylinders. Rotary shaft seals are designed to seal shafts that rotate in one or both directions.

Proper maintenance of oil seals is crucial to ensure their longevity and efficiency in preventing fluid leakage. Over time, oil seals can wear out due to factors such as friction, heat, and exposure to contaminants. Regular inspection of oil seals is necessary to detect signs of wear or damage, such as leaks, cracks, or hardening of the rubber. Timely replacement of worn-out seals is essential to avoid costly repairs and downtime.
